Current Scenario: Paving the Way for Progress
The Bamako-Dakar Railway Revitalization
The revitalization of the Bamako-Dakar railway is a crucial project for Mali's transportation sector. This railway, connecting Mali's capital, Bamako, to Senegal's capital, Dakar, plays a vital role in facilitating trade and regional integration. The ongoing modernization effort includes track rehabilitation, new rolling stock, and improved signaling systems.
The Taoussa Hydroelectric Dam Project
Access to reliable and affordable electricity is essential for Mali's growth and development. The Taoussa hydroelectric dam project, located on the Niger River, is set to significantly boost the country's power generation capacity. Upon completion, the dam will provide much-needed electricity to rural areas, supporting local industries and improving the quality of life for millions of Malians.
The Bamako-S?gou Expressway
The Bamako-S?gou expressway project is aimed at improving connectivity between Mali's capital and the important regional city of S?gou. This 240-kilometer, four-lane highway will not only reduce travel time but also boost trade and promote economic development along the corridor.
The Bamako International Airport Expansion
With air travel becoming increasingly important for Mali's economy and tourism industry, the Bamako International Airport is undergoing a significant expansion. The project includes the construction of a new terminal, additional parking spaces, and improved air traffic control facilities, enhancing the airport's capacity and efficiency.
Industry Outlook: Crafting a Vision for a Vibrant Mali
The Trans-Saharan Highway Project
The Trans-Saharan Highway project aims to connect North Africa and West Africa through a network of modern highways. Mali, strategically located along this route, stands to benefit from the increased trade and regional integration the highway will bring. The completion of the project will open up new opportunities for Mali's economy, attracting investment and creating jobs.
Expansion of the Telecommunications Infrastructure
As the world becomes increasingly interconnected, the need for robust telecommunications infrastructure is paramount. Mali's government is working to expand mobile and internet connectivity across the country, with a focus on rural areas. Improved digital infrastructure will have a ripple effect, enhancing access to education, healthcare, and financial services.
Developing Sustainable and Eco-Friendly Infrastructure
Sustainability is becoming a top priority for infrastructure development in Mali. Projects like the Djenn? Solar Park, with a planned capacity of 50 megawatts, demonstrate the country's commitment to adopting renewable energy sources and reducing reliance on fossil fuels. The focus on sustainable infrastructure will create a cleaner, greener future for Mali.
